Bulgarian[edit]

Etymology[edit]

Inherited from Proto-Slavic *plakati.

Pronunciation[edit]

Verb[edit]

пла́ча (pláča) first-singular present indicativeimpf

  1. (intransitive) to cry, to weep
    Synonyms: рева (reva), цивря (civrja)
  2. (intransitive) to wail
    Synonym: вайкам (vajkam)
  3. (reflexive with се, dialectal) to complain, to whine about
